R语言读取csv文件

原文链接

csv文件一般是用的最多的数据文件格式,这一节主要介绍怎么读取csv文件。

这个文件

这里在D盘根目录下面有一个csv文件,可以下面对其进行一些操作。

读取文件

```

> dat <- read.csv('D:\\1.csv',header = TRUE)

> dat

  id name age score

1  0   ky  22    70

2  1   kg  23    80

3  2   kq  24    90

```

对于一般逗号作为分隔符的文本文件,也是可以用read.csv()读取的。

> dat2 <- read.csv('D:\\2.txt',header = FALSE)

> dat2

   V1  V2  V3

1 110 210 310

2 120 300 400

这里强调一下,因为headers参数有默认参数值,有的函数headers默认值是true,有的是false,这个记不住,也不好记,我们根据文件有头部就是true,没有就false,这样就不会出错了。

写文件

写文件用write.csv(dat,file,row.names,...)

比如这里,我们把数据dat写入一个csv文件里面去:

> write.csv(dat,'D:\\csv.csv',row.names = FALSE)

打开这个新生成的文件长这样:

显然,这是符合我们的要求的。

关于R语言读取csv文件,就是这么多。每天学习一点点,每天都要进步!

原文链接

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 在R语言中,我们可以从存储在R语言环境外的文件中读取数据。 我们还可以将数据写入将被操作系统存储和访问的文件。 R...
    yuanyb阅读 2,143评论 0 1
  • R语言与数据挖掘:公式;数据;方法 R语言特征 对大小写敏感 通常,数字,字母,. 和 _都是允许的(在一些国家还...
    __一蓑烟雨__阅读 1,711评论 0 5
  • 将数据输入或加载到R工作空间中,是使用R进行数据分析的第一步。R语言支持读取众多格式的数据文件,excel文件,c...
    oncology咕噜阅读 2,004评论 0 5
  • 渐变的面目拼图要我怎么拼? 我是疲乏了还是投降了? 不是不允许自己坠落, 我没有滴水不进的保护膜。 就是害怕变得面...
    闷热当乘凉阅读 4,367评论 0 13
  • 感觉自己有点神经衰弱,总是觉得手机响了;屋外有人走过;每次妈妈不声不响的进房间突然跟我说话,我都会被吓得半死!一整...
    章鱼的拥抱阅读 2,233评论 4 5